In 2013, ship's cook Harrison Okene became trapped inside the sunken Jascon-4, nearly 100 feet underwater.
For around 60 hours, he survived inside a small pocket of trapped air in complete darkness and freezing water, waiting for someone to find him.
Then something unbelievable happened: during a recovery operation, divers discovered that Harrison was still alive.
His incredible rescue became a remarkable story of survival, human endurance, diving science, and hope against impossible odds.
